Interview in Virus#23
Cyberpunk Influences:
William Gibson: (back to the list) Alfred Bester, yeah. Bester I'll go for. [William Burroughs'] Naked Lunch, yes. Philip K. Dick, though, had almost no influence.
Tom Maddox: Right, you've really never much really read...
William Gibson: I never really read Dick because I read Pynchon. You don't need Dick if you've read Pynchon. I mean Dick was the guy who couldn't quite do it.
Tom Maddox: Ah, I think that's different, but you haven't read Dick, Bill (laughs).
